# stale

> English word · Adjective · IPA /steɪl/ · frequency rank #16,589

## Definitions
1. Clear, free of dregs and lees; old and strong.
2. No longer fresh, in reference to food, urine, straw, wounds, etc.
3. No longer fresh, new, or interesting, in reference to ideas and immaterial things; clichéd, hackneyed, dated.
4. No longer nubile or suitable for marriage, in reference to people; past one's prime.
5. Not new or recent; having been in place or in effect for some time.
6. Fallow, in reference to land.
7. Unreasonably long in coming, in reference to claims and actions.
8. Worn out, particularly due to age or over-exertion, in reference to athletes and animals in competition.
9. Out of date, unpaid for an unreasonable amount of time, particularly in reference to checks.
10. Of data: out of date; not synchronized with the newest copy.

## Etymology
From Middle English stale, from Old French estal (“fixed position, place”), but probably originally from Proto-Germanic *stāną (“to stand”): compare West Flemish stel in the same sense for ‘beer’ and ‘urine’.
